What the Greater Cambridge Energy Project includes
At its core, the Greater Cambridge Energy Project (GCEP) revolves around reinforcing the local transmission and distribution network that feeds Cambridge and nearby communities, an area where Eversource has identified strong load growth and limited existing capacity. The project scope, according to Eversource and regional grid-planning documents, includes new underground transmission lines, upgrades in existing rights-of-way, and the expansion or modification of several substations in and around Cambridge to increase both capacity and operational flexibility. The utility frames these measures as necessary to continue delivering reliable power to critical institutions, including world-renowned research universities and hospitals, while accommodating new commercial and residential developments that depend on stable electric service. As part of Eversource’s broader decarbonization strategy, the upgraded grid sections are also designed to better integrate distributed energy resources and support electrification of heating and transportation over time, according to the company’s carbon-neutral operations roadmap published on its careers and corporate pages. For local stakeholders, one of the defining features of GCEP is the use of underground lines in a dense urban environment where above-ground infrastructure is often impractical. Underground construction is more complex and typically more expensive than overhead lines, but it can reduce exposure to weather-related outages and free up surface space, a key point in a city where research facilities, offices and multifamily housing compete for every parcel. Eversource has detailed in public siting and community-outreach materials how construction is being phased to limit disruption, including traffic management, noise-control commitments and coordination with municipal infrastructure work. In parallel, the company has engaged with institutions along the route to schedule sensitive work around laboratory operations and campus schedules, a process that can affect both construction timelines and cost profiles. These design and outreach steps underline that GCEP is not just an engineering project but also a negotiated fit into a constrained urban landscape, balancing reliability goals with neighborhood impact as part of regulatory approvals documented in state siting and planning proceedings. The project also sits within a wider policy and planning context that extends beyond Cambridge itself. Regional reliability assessments for the U.S. Northeast, including commentary from system planners, have pointed to the importance of timely transmission and distribution upgrades to keep pace with both data centers and electrification of transport and heating loads. For a regulated utility such as Eversource, large grid projects typically enter the rate base after regulatory review, meaning costs are ultimately recovered from customers subject to oversight on prudence and necessity. That ties GCEP to broader debates seen elsewhere in New England over bill impacts, investment pacing and the balance between central grid upgrades and local solutions such as behind-the-meter solar or storage. Eversource, for its part, highlights on its public channels that investments like GCEP are aligned with its goal of being carbon-neutral in operations by 2030, with upgraded infrastructure expected to enable more renewable integration, electric vehicle charging and building decarbonization over the long term.
